Output 18738626dbe457b8de1d689cedd377339193134a0a25377feb0205e176c2de73:0

value
26626432
script pubkey
OP_0 OP_PUSHBYTES_20 77ea86af854ec397e78662800b937ab2213f964a
address
bc1qwl4gdtu9fmpe0euxv2qqhym6kgsnl9j23j2mwk
transaction
18738626dbe457b8de1d689cedd377339193134a0a25377feb0205e176c2de73
spent
true